#f5e5c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f5e5c2 is composed of 96.1% red, 89.8%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.5% magenta, 20.8%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 41.2 degrees, a saturation of 71.8% and a lightness of 86.1%. #f5e5c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ebcb85.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#f5e5c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f5e5c2 has RGB values of R:245, G:229,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.07, Y:0.21,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16115138.
